Robotics Labs Choose Reliability
At Munich’s AutoBotX facility, robotic arms drawing 47A intermittent loads found their match. The FWP-50B’s time-delay characteristic (t=4s at 500% overload) prevents nuisance blowing during motor startups. Lab manager Clara Voss states: We’ve extended preventive maintenance cycles from 6 to 9 months since adoption.
Engineers’ Secret Weapon
What makes it tick? The dual-element design combines fast-acting short-circuit protection with overload tolerance. UL listed and RoHS compliant, it’s packing tech that’s 30% more compact than comparable fuses – a space saver in crowded control panels.
